友快網

導航選單

Python入門最完整的基礎知識大全【純乾貨, 建議收藏】

作為一個有著多年

Python

開發經驗的老碼農,今天我就為大家帶來了Python的基礎知識點,全篇乾貨,建議大家動動手指收藏起來,一定能夠幫助你順利入門Python!

1、環境搭建

Python由荷蘭數學和計算機科學研究學會的Guido van Rossum 於1990 年代初設計。Python提供了高效的高階資料結構,還能簡單有效地面向物件程式設計。

Python具備可移植性,可以在多個平臺執行,這裡給大家帶來的是

Windows

平臺的環境搭建。

(1)下載安裝包

需要到Python的官網上下載Windows系統的安裝包就可以了。根據自己電腦的系統選擇32位或者64位。

(2)安裝

點選載入圖片

雙擊,勾選Add Python to PATH(新增Python到環境變數),然後選擇Customize Installation(自定義安裝)。

2、入門工具

(1)IDLE

這是Python自帶的編輯器。按下Windows鍵,輸入idle或者python就可以看到。

使用方法:輸入print點選回車,就可以輸出。要輸入print時,輸入pr然後按下tab鍵就會有提示。重複上一行程式碼使用快捷鍵Alt+p,切回下一行程式碼時使用Alt+n。

(2)Sublime Text3

去官網下載就可以了,安裝比較簡單。

使用方法:ctrl+n建立新檔案,ctrl+s儲存檔案。

3、Python基礎知識

(1)在菜鳥教程有非常全面的基礎知識。在上面可以找到不同Python版本的知識點。

點選載入圖片

(2)基礎知識點

python物件:

身份:物件的唯一標識,可使用內建函式id得到 型別:物件型別決定物件操作,eg:不可能對一個str物件進行判斷empty檢驗。可使用內建函式type進行檢視。由於型別也是python物件,所以要判斷某物件是不是什麼型別,可使用:type(obj)== type(dict{}) 值:物件的資料值,若物件支援更新操作,則可修改。eg:tuple和list的區別。

物件屬性:

常見包含資料屬性物件:類、類例項、模組。

標準型別:

點選載入圖片

其他內建型別:

點選載入圖片

注:

點選載入圖片

基本型別的分類:使用以下三種模型進行分類。

儲存模型:python的物件能容納一個或多個值,一個能保留單個字面獨享的型別,成為原子或標量儲存。eg:數值、字串。

那些可容納多個物件的型別,稱之為容器儲存。eg:列表、元組、字典。

更新模型:某些物件的型別允許它們的值改變,即可變物件(列表、字典)。而不可變物件則不允許它們的值被更改。(數字、字串、元組)。可使用id(obj)檢視物件標識。

訪問模型:分為三種訪問方式:直接存取(對於非容器型別)、順序(字串、列表、元組)和對映(字典)。

標準型別分類:

點選載入圖片

不支援的型別:

char和byte 使用字串代替 2)指標 使用id檢視地址,但是不能操作該值 3)int、short、long python的×××等同於long,無需自己維護變數長度 4)float、double python的浮點數等同於C的double。

type和isinstance:

type是python的內建函式,會返回python物件的型別,不限於基本型別 eg:import types type(num) == types。IntType isinstance(obj, (int, float, 。。。)),接受一個物件型別元組作為引數。

xrange與range:

點選載入圖片

str與repr:

點選載入圖片

點選載入圖片

結語:

學習貴在堅持!

我也是從零基礎過來的,非常懂很多小夥伴的心情,孤軍作戰總是非常孤獨的,學習還是要找到一群志同道合的朋友一起學,才更容易堅持下去。

上一篇:九月出新品, iPhone13改變很小, 螢幕更新是重點!
下一篇:“人類高質量男性”的真面目, 原來就這?